在数字技术飞速发展的时代,区块链作为一种颠覆性的技术,正不断吸引着全球范围内的关注和投资。Substrate,作为一款功能强大的区块链开发框架,正在为开发者提供一种更为灵活、高效的手段,探索区块链的无限可能。无论是在去中心化金融(DeFi)、非同质化代币(NFT),还是在其他各类去中心化应用(DApp)的开发上,Substrate都展现出了其独特的优势和广阔的前景。
Substrate由Parity Technologies(之前是Parity Ethereum的开发团队)创建,它的核心目标在于降低区块链开发的门槛,让开发者能够更快地构建自己的区块链。通过Trading systems、Landing (Borrowing)、Tokens发行与管理等,使得Substrate平台实现了传统金融行业、Web3.0时代的无缝衔接。
Substrate极大地简化了区块链的开发流程,其强大的模块化结构,使得开发者无需从零开始,可以基于现有的模块进行快速开发,甚至可以自定义模块。这为区块链的创新提供了极大的空间与可能性,使得开发者能够更加专注于业务逻辑的实现,而不是底层技术的搭建。
Substrate的确切优势在于它的模块化开发结构。通过这一设计,开发者可以选择适合自己需求的模块进行组合,灵活构建出符合自己业务需求的区块链。例如,开发者可以选择不同的共识算法,或是引入特定的网络协议。这种灵活性极大促进了不同应用场景下的区块链脱颖而出。
并且,Substrate支持升级与分叉,使得开发者可以随时根据业务需求进行功能扩展,而无须经历传统区块链的“痛苦升级”。一旦创建了自己的链,开发者可以在不影响主链的情况下,随时进行智能合约的查看、升级与,这种便捷性不仅大大提高了开发效率,也为区块链的持续发展提供了保障。
在现今多样化的区块链生态中,Substrate与以太坊、EOS等其他区块链平台相比,拥有其独特的竞争优势。以太坊的智能合约虽然成熟,但是链的灵活性相对较低,应用场景的扩展可能需要更高的技术门槛。而EOS的治理模型虽然降低了用户的参与难度,但其本质上仍然是一个单链系统,缺乏Substrate所提供的多链联动功能。
以太坊的最大优势在于其庞大的开发者社区和现成的DApp生态系统,但同时,由于其链上复杂的操作流程,导致了高额的手续费和拥堵的问题。而Substrate利用其模块化结构,让开发者可以迅速搭建出低手续费、专属需求的区块链,尤其在需要快速迭代的场景中表现尤为突出。
Substrate的生态正在逐渐形成,许多基于Substrate的项目如Polkadot、Kusama等,都在推动去中心化应用的不断演进与发展。Polkadot作为Ethereum 2.0的竞争者,正以其独特的跨链功能,吸引着越来越多的项目加入其生态,为Substrate提供了更广阔的应用舞台。
在此背景下,许多开发者正在借助Substrate强大的开发工具,推出创新型应用,涵盖了去中心化交易所、跨链钱包、稳定币等多种形式。这一切标志着Substrate正在成为区块链技术发展的重要推动力。
大规模的区块链应用逐渐成为现实,Substrate作为开发者的首选工具,其未来发展前景相当乐观。目前,许多行业巨头和初创公司都在积极探索基于Substrate的应用,相信会在未来几个月或几年内看到惊人的进展。Substrate的框架也在不断更新,更多的功能模块将会被引入,不断推动区块链内容的丰富性与扩展性。
同时,Substrate在治理、自定义经济模型、可扩展性等各个方面也展现出了巨大的潜力。随着底层技术的不断进化,Substrate入口的发展,将有效增强区块链技术的市场认可度与应用基础,成为区块链开展商业变革的主流平台之一。
Substrate为区块链的创新提供了前所未有的灵活性,这主要得益于其模块化的设计结构和动态升级能力。通过基于模块的搭建,开发者能够根据自己的需求,快速选择和组合不同的功能模块,这在传统的区块链开发流程中是难以实现的。例如,开发者可以用Substrate快速构建出符合行业需求的去中心化金融应用,或是非同质化代币(NFT)市场,无需关注底层技术的复杂性。这里的灵活性极大地降低了创新的门槛,让更多的开发者参与到区块链的构建中。
另一方面,Substrate强大的升级功能意味着开发者可以在不影响主链稳定性的情况下,快速进行应用的版本迭代。这样一来,项目的创新性就在于可以实现用户需求与市场变化的及时响应,而不再埋藏在技术的限制中,甚至可能因顾虑分叉风险而需谨慎行事。
此外,Substrate的社区支持和丰富的文档资源也为开发者的创新活动提供了良好的环境。开发者可以利用现有的生态系统和网络资源,分享经验、合作开发并展现各自的产品。这种生态的形成,不仅促进了技术的共享与知识推广,进而推动了整个区块链的创新。
Substrate平台为去中心化治理提供了全新的可能性。通过非常灵活的网络协议与治理机制,Substrate允许区块链网络的持有者根据协议共同管理网络的方向。这种治理的有效性在于,它能够让所有参与者共同参与到系统的决策中,避免了中心化机构主导的风险。
具体来说,Substrate的去中心化治理机制以代币持有者投票的方式运作。每个代币持有者根据其持有的代币数量,对提案进行表决。所提出的提案可以包括协议变更、功能更新以及经济模型调整等。这种机制确保了每个代币持有者都能对系统的发展方向产生影响,从而增强了社区的参与感与归属感。
这种治理方式的优势在于,避免了某些特定利益集团在决策过程中的主导地位。随着项目的发展,参与者可以持续自由参与社区治理,并根据社区的实际情况实施适应性的调整和改进,最终实现更为健康稳定的生态体系。
Substrate的技术架构由多个层次组成,其中每一层都有其独特的功能和职责。在最低层,Substrate提供了高度可配置的底层协议,开发者可以根据自己需求自由选择共识机制、网络和存储等技术模块。
接下来,Substrate在协议层提供了一系列的功能模块,包括合约执行、账户管理、资产转移、因子机等,根据应用需求,可以自由拼装以及扩展。而在应用层,开发者可以基于模块化的设计,快速高效地构建去中心化应用。这种设计带来的好处是,开发者能够以极低的时间和资源成本,快速验证想法并进入市场。
此外,Substrate的框架支持支持与Polkadot生态系统无缝连接,使得开发者可以轻松地实现跨链交易与多链并行操作。这种互操作性,使得基于Substrate的区块链能够在大规模网络中进行高效的通讯和数据交换,让投资人和开发者们不再局限于单一链的限制。
对于想要入门Substrate开发的人员来说,了解其文档、实践项目以及参与社区是相当重要的第一步。Substrate官方文档是一个极好的起点,涵盖了从基础概念到实际开发的诸多内容。通过阅读文档,学习Substrate特定的API与生态工具,可以为个人开发路线打下良好的基础。
其次,积极参与Substrate的开发者社区也是非常关键的。通过更新最新项目、分享经验以及与其他开发者共同合作,不仅能提高个人的开发能力,还能为整个生态的建设贡献力量。此外,在线课程、培训与黑客松活动已经在许多地方如火如荼地进行着,这也是一个学习与实践的好平台。
最后,参与开源项目并从中学习是加快入门的有效方式。许多项目已经基于Substrate构建,通过贡献代码、修复bug、功能,可以加深对Substrate框架的理解。这种实践经验和真实应用的参与,能大大提高开发者的能力与项目经验,也为未来的职业发展提供了确实的保障。
Substrate的出现为区块链技术的发展注入了强大的动力,未来它将继续发挥关键作用。其灵活的模块化架构能够满足不同应用场景的需求,使更多的组织和个人能够参与到区块链建设中,从而推动技术的普及和应用的发展。
未来可预见,Substrate将成为新一代区块链应用的主要搭建基底。其在支持多链结构方面的能力,将使得区块链的互操作性能显著提升,为用户提供更多元化的选择。此外,Substrate的创建者Parity Technologies还在不断引入新的技术设施与方法,确保其能够适应瞬息万变的市场与技术需求。
随着去中心化金融、NFT、DAO等各种区块链生态的快速飞速增长,Substrate将为开发者提供更为强大的工具和框架支持。通过与其它顶尖技术的联合应用,Substrate将推动形成一个更加健全、更具创新力的区块链生态体系,最终实现商业模式的彻底升级。
leave a reply